ST. PATRICK’S DAY
St. Patrick’s Day kicks off a worldwide celebration also known as the Feast of St. Patrick. On March 17th, many will wear green in honor of the Irish and decorate with shamrocks. According to lore, the wearing of the green tradition dates back to a story written about St. Patrick in 1726. St. Patrick (c. AD 385–461) used the shamrock to illustrate the Holy Trinity and worn green clothing. And while the story is unlikely to be true, many will revel in the Irish heritage and eat traditional Irish fare, too.

Ides of March
The Ides of March is the day on the Roman calendar marked as the Idus, roughly the midpoint of a month, of Martius, corresponding to 15 March on the Gregorian calendar. It was marked by several major religious observances. -
Beware the Ides of March
March 15, 44 B.C.
Julius Caesar is assassinated on the Ides of March by a group of conspirators led by Marcus Brutus. According to the historian Plutarch, a fortune teller had warned Caesar, “beware the Ides of March.” This event was immortalized in Shakespeare’s play Julius Caesar.
The word Ides is from Latin, meaning to divide, and is the 15th day of March, May, July, October, and the 13th day of the other months in the ancient Roman calendar. At one time, the Ides of March marked the new year. -

As fyi, This was interesting. HOAs and Service Animals:
Under federal law, HOAs are required to make reasonable accommodations for service animals, including emotional support animals (ESAs).
No Pet Restrictions:
HOAs cannot impose “no pet policies” that would exclude service animals.
Documentation:
If the need for a service animal is not immediately apparent, the HOA can request documentation to verify the need, such as a letter from a medical professional.
Limited Inquiry:
The HOA can only ask two questions: “Is the animal a service animal required because of a disability?” and “What work or task has the animal been trained to perform?”.
No Information about Disability:
The HOA cannot ask for details about the person’s disability, nor can they require proof of training or certification. -

NATIONAL PI DAY
National Pi Day on March 14th recognizes the mathematical constant π. Also known as pi, the first three and most recognized digits are 3.14. The day is celebrated by pi enthusiasts and pie lovers alike!Pi is the ratio between the circumference of a circle and its diameter. While the idea of pi has been known for nearly 4000 years, accurately calculating it has been something of slightly more recent mathematical development. By 2000 BC, the Egyptians and Babylonians accurately used the constant to build. Mathematicians such as Archimedes, Fibonacci, François Viète, Adriaan van Roomen, and Gottfried Wilhelm Leibniz all calculated pi by various methods. However, in 1706, Welsh mathematician William Jones introduced the Greek letter π to represent the ratio of a circle’s circumference; pi.

Set your alarms to see a total lunar eclipse this Thursday night/Friday morning!
Watch as the full Moon passes through Earth’s shadow, then turns a spectacular red-orange hue during totality. During a lunar eclipse, the Sun, Earth, and Moon are aligned like this:
Eclipse timeline (in central time):
10:57 pm, March 13: Eclipse begins. The full Moon will begin to diminish in brightness as it enters Earth’s outer shadow, called the penumbra.
12:09 am, March 14: The Moon, full but dim, enters Earth’s inner shadow, called the umbra.
1:26 am: Totality begins! The Moon appears red as it is now fully inside Earth’s umbra.
1:58 am: Maximum eclipse (if you only get up once to see the eclipse, this is the best time!): The deep red Moon is near the center of Earth’s shadow.
2:31 am: Totality ends: The Moon begins to exit Earth’s umbra.
3:47 am: The Moon is now fully outside of the umbra but still in the penumbra. The red color has faded.
5:00 am: Is anyone still watching? The eclipse ends as the full Moon exits Earth’s shadow and returns to its normal brightness.
